An observer moves towards a stationary source of sound, with a velocity one-fifth of the velocity
of sound, What is the percentage increase in the apparent frequency ?
detailed solution
Correct option is D
v0=v5⇒v0=3205=64ms−1When observer moves towards the stationary source, thenn′=v+v0vn⇒n′=320+64320n or n′=384320n or n′n=384320The percentage increase in the apparent frequency n′n−1100%=384320−1100%=20%Talk to our academic expert!
